组组组合拳艰难渗透

💡 原文中文,约1900字,阅读约需5分钟。
📝

内容提要

本文探讨了现代渗透测试中的攻防演练,强调信息收集和代码审计的重要性。通过源码分析,发现文件上传和SQL注入漏洞,成功伪造管理员身份获取后台权限。总结指出,灵活运用多种技术和理解系统机制对快速获取靶标分数至关重要。

🎯

关键要点

  • 现代攻防演练需要多种技术组合,而非单一漏洞利用。

  • 信息收集是渗透测试的第一步,包括目录扫描和文件下载。

  • 源码分析揭示了文件上传和SQL注入漏洞的存在。

  • 文件上传漏洞未对文件格式进行过滤,导致攻击者可以上传恶意文件。

  • SQL注入难以实现,但通过未鉴权的接口获取了系统用户信息。

  • 伪造管理员身份需要理解系统的登录鉴权机制。

  • 成功获取管理员后台后,获得了靶标分数。

  • 灵活运用多种技术和理解系统机制对快速获取靶标分数至关重要。

延伸问答

现代渗透测试中,信息收集的第一步是什么?

信息收集的第一步是进行目录扫描和文件下载,以获取靶标的清单和系统界面。

源码分析中发现了哪些漏洞?

源码分析中发现了文件上传漏洞和SQL注入漏洞。

文件上传漏洞的主要问题是什么?

文件上传漏洞的主要问题是未对上传的文件格式进行过滤,允许攻击者上传恶意文件。

如何伪造管理员身份以获取后台权限?

伪造管理员身份需要理解系统的登录鉴权机制,并通过构造有效的jwt_token进行身份伪装。

在渗透测试中,灵活运用多种技术有什么重要性?

灵活运用多种技术可以帮助快速获取靶标分数,避免错过有用的信息。

渗透测试的最终目标是什么?

渗透测试的最终目标是高效快速地获取靶标分数。

➡️

继续阅读